| Multifrequency and parametric EIT images of neonatal lungs. | |

The aims of the study were to investigate the problems involved in making multifrequency EIT measurements on neonates and to compare the images obtained with the results from a group of normal adults. The Sheffield electrical impedance tomographic spectroscopy (EITS) system acquires multifrequency data using a set of eight drive and eight receive electrodes. EITS measurements were made on an inhomogeneous group of 10 neonates admitted to the special care baby unit for observation and feeding. R/S, characteristic frequency, RC and SC parameters were generated using the Cole equation. Comparisons of the parameters were made with data collected from normal adults in another study. We have shown that it is possible to obtain EITS parametric images of neonatal lungs and that there are some differences in Cole parameters between the adult and neonatal groups. |
